Description David Fellows 2006-01-01 09:50:47 UTC
The following error is observed on a x86 system with openoffice-bin-2.0.0 and an amd64 system with openoffice-bin-2.0.0 and currently 2.0.1.  

It happens every time you start openoffice.  

The following error dialog pops up some minutes after starting Openoffice.  It does not seem to be related to what you are currently doing (including doing nothing at all).

Error loading BASIC of document
file:///opt/OpenOffice.org/share/basic/WebWizard/script.xlb/:
General Error
General input/output error.

After clicking to close the error dialog, you get a second one complaing about file:///opt/OpenOffice.org/share/basic/WebWizard/dialog.xlb/:

After closing this error dialog, there are no further error dialogs. There is no 
problem continuing working on what you were doing.

I have tried using the WebWizard. File->WIzards->Web Page.
It worked with no missing file errors. Except that clicking the Preview button resulted in AbiWord 2.2 being launched as the browser! That would appear to be a different problem - I don't want to go there at this time.

Version 2 was installed as an emerge upgrade from openoffice-bin-1.1.5 version on both systems.
